In “Far Out” magazine, David Gilmour named his 6 favorite Pink Floyd songs:

-Comfortably Numb (co-written with Roger)
-Echoes (all members are credited)
-Shine On You Crazy Diamond (co-written with Roger)
-Wish You Were Here (co-written with Roger)
-High Hopes (co-written with Polly)
-The Great Gig In The Sky (Wright/Torry)
